It is almost a year since a Yorkshire Terror dog called Hugo went missing from his Saddleworth home and his heartbroken owner Kelly Teece is making a fresh appeal for any information on his whereabouts.

Hugo is a cross Yorkshire terrier and he turned three on the 17 March whilst still missing, he went missing from the saddleworth area and there were some initial sightings around Oldham & Tameside.

The annual Rushcart Festival has taken place in Saddleworth this weekend with the Saddleworth Morris Men and others from around the country taking part in various Morris dancing displays.

Pupils in Oldham have maintained high standards following the publication of today’s GCSE results.

Early indications* suggest the majority of all local schools have improved or maintained their results in gaining five grade A* to C passes (including English and maths) – despite a national sharp drop in English.

Across Oldham as a whole, 56.5 per cent of students achieved at least five of these grades.

Four people have been arrested in connection with a man’s death in Saddleworth.

At around 10.40am on Monday 24 February 2014, police were called to Dovestones Reservoir in Greenfield, following reports that a body had been seen.

When officers attended, supported by an underwater search team the body of 28-year-old Craig Wilcox was recovered from the water.

A post mortem examination was carried out, but the result was inconclusive.

The winners of Oldham Council’s well-received Bloom and Grow Photography Competition have been announced.

The standard was golden this year as we gained more than 700 entries over the six-week competition.

In first place – winning £200 – was a stunning photograph of Tandle Hill Country Park taken by Dan Shaw, from Shaw.

The amateur photographer took his prize-winning shot on his smartphone.

The Yanks event has returned to Saddleworth this weekend with something for everyone to see and do including a spectacular fly-past by a Lancaster Bomber later today and an appearance from one of the stars of the original film.

This very popular annual event was first staged 13 years ago to celebrate the local filming of the Hollywood movie “YANKS” in 1979 starring Richard Gere. Many locations in Uppermill and […]

The Amateur Dram society is hosting a whisky tasting event at Diggle Band Club in support of the Oldham Mountain Rescue Team, who celebrate their 50th anniversary this year.

The event, which takes place on Saturday 4 October, allows people to try nine whiskies from around the world and enjoy a pie and peas supper, courtesy of the Little Saddleworth Pie Company.

The co-ordinator in Gaza for a local charity that raises money to help Palestinian women access further education has suffered the dreadful loss of 11 family members killed by Israeli shelling in the Gaza Strip. Five of the family members were children, the youngest being 4 years old.

Eighties singer and songwriter Lloyd Cole is to play a concert in Uppermill this month in the very same building his mother and father first met almost sixty years ago. The Civic Hall on Lee Street was then called the Mechanics Institute.

Lloyd who was lead singer of Lloyd Cole and the Commotions from 1984 to 1989 was born in Buxton and grew up in nearby Chapel-en-le-Frith […]
